Chemical Engineering: Pros and Cons . Chemical engineering is one of the better-paying engineering jobs. The discipline racks up an average pay in the low six figures, with around 10 percent of chemical engineers earning a wage of $150,000 annually. Chemical engineers also have their pick of industries to work in.For example, chemical engineering covers a broad area including biomedicine, food, electronics, and the environment. One graduate with chemical engineering could work in many industries. Whereas, petroleum engineering is more direct, which deals primarily with the extraction of oil and gas. Dr. Josephine Hill, PhD, is transforming harmful by-products of oil and gas processing – such as petroleum coke – into catalysts for heavy oil upgrading. Repurposing these waste materials results in energy savings, improved reaction times and the removal of contaminants from the environment. Petroleum engineering has historically been one of the highest-paid engineering disciplines, although there is a tendency for mass layoffs when oil prices decline and waves of hiring as prices rise. In 2020, the United States Department of Labor's Bureau of Labor Statistics reported the median pay for petroleum engineers was US$137,330, or roughly $66.02 per hour. Chemical Engineering Salary. The Bureau of Labor Statistics states that as of May 2021, chemical engineers earned a mean of $121,840 per year, or $58.58 per hour.
